Latest Patents
Ashutosh holds a patent for a "Computing platform for bioprocess design, execution, analysis, and technology transfer." This patent encompasses meth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media. The platform supports bioprocess design, execution, analysis, and technology transfer. One of the key methods involves receiving a facilities specification from a production facility, which represents the properties and capabilities of each item of equipment. The platform then selects a recipe to be transferred as a production plan and performs a matching process between unit operations of the selected recipe and the equipment specifications. This results in a production plan that includes equipment-specific production tasks tailored for the production facility.
